1952 Plea for Increased Funding for the National Institute of Neurological Diseases and Blindness, 1952-01-17

Scope and Contents
The letter is a plea for increased funding for the National Institute of Neurological Diseases and Blindness in the 1953 budget. It emphasizes the importance of this funding in bringing hope to millions of handicapped individuals and relieving human suffering.
